I worked at a company on Boston MA for all 12 months in 2021 but only lived their June through September. Otherwise lived in Florida. Do I have to pay full year of MA state taxes?

Per Mass Department of Revenue:
There are special rules for wages or other compensation paid to employees who are working remotely (working from home or a location other than their usual work location) due to the COVID-19 Pandemic. For tax years 2020 and 2021, compensation paid to a nonresident for services that would normally be performed in Massachusetts are treated as Massachusetts source income subject to tax if they are performed in another state due to a Pandemic Related Circumstance and should be reported as taxable income on Form 1-NR/PY.
